About This Item
NY: John Lane, 1900. 1st American edition.. Hardcover. Very Good. 8vo. Hardcover, decorative cloth. Exterior lightly scuffed, board edges rubbed, inner front hinge paper splitting (but board, binding firm). Small closed tear at bottom of Preface pg & final 2 pgs. Otherwise vg condition, clean & tight, all plates present. 245 pp. Dated inscription on front flyleaf, "Christmas 1907".
